What do these speeds mean? 10-30 Mbps: Good for browsing and streaming. 30-100 Mbps: Great for multiple users and HD streaming. 100-300 Mbps: Excellent for 4K streaming and gaming. 300+ Mbps: Perfect for large households and heavy internet use.

About this EPC: Energy Performance Certificates are valid for 10 years and are required when a property is built, sold, or rented. Learn more about EPCs or book an EPC assessment.
